To truly understand the impact of performers like Jarek and Jamie, it's essential to understand the unique world they entered. Founded in September 2001, Sean Cody became famous for its strict casting rules, with contracts that required models to have no prior pornographic experience. This created an aura of authenticity, presenting a lineup of fit, athletic young men with wholesome, "guy-next-door" looks. Although some models later identified as gay or bisexual, the studio's hallmark was its "gay-for-pay" casting, which captivated audiences with a specific fantasy of "real" men and real chemistry.
